Multitouch ThinkPad X200 Tablet Review

BY: Kevin O'Brien, TabletPCReview.com Editor
PUBLISHED: 10/5/2009

Lenovo recently unveiled a new version of the X200 Tablet, offering Windows 7, a faster processor option, and now multitouch support. New to this model is a two-finger multitouch display, as well as the 2.16GHz Intel SL9600 Core 2 Duo Processor. Over on NotebookReview.com we put the X200 Tablet through a battery of tests, and find out a number of cool things about this particular tablet that makes it one of the best we have seen in a long time.
